Market Overview
The global ASIC Bitcoin mining hardware market was valued at USD 10.5 billion in 2024 and is projected to reach USD 22.63 billion by 2033, growing at a CAGR of 8.9% during the forecast period. This growth is driven by Bitcoin's increasing adoption, advancements in ASIC chip technology, and the expansion of mining operations into energy-efficient regions.
Key Growth Drivers:
- Bitcoin Adoption: Rising popularity as a digital currency fuels demand for high-performance mining hardware.
- Technological Advancements: Innovations in ASIC design enhance hashing power and energy efficiency.
- Geographical Expansion: Miners targeting regions with low-cost renewable energy sources.
COVID-19 Impact Analysis
The pandemic disrupted global supply chains, causing manufacturing delays and hardware shortages. Key effects included:
- Supply Chain Issues: Component shortages extended lead times for ASIC miners.
- Demand Decline: Reduced revenue due to lower mining activity during lockdowns.
- Recovery: Market rebound expected as supply chains stabilize post-pandemic.

Market Segmentation
By Type
| Cryptocurrency | Description |
|---|---|
| BTC | Dominates ASIC mining due to Bitcoin's SHA-256 algorithm. |
| LTC | Scrypt-based mining, though less prevalent than BTC. |
| ETH | Transitioned to proof-of-stake, reducing ASIC demand. |
| Others | Includes altcoins with unique mining algorithms. |
By Application
Mining Farms
- Large-scale operations utilizing clusters of ASIC miners.
- Largest market segment due to economies of scale.
Mining Pool Services
- Enable individual miners to combine computational resources.
- Growing popularity among small-scale miners.

Competitive Landscape
Top ASIC Mining Hardware Manufacturers:
- BitMain (China)
- MicroBT (China)
- Canaan Creative (China)
- Ebang (China)
- Innosilicon (China)
Strategies:
- Continuous R&D to launch energy-efficient models.
- Partnerships with renewable energy providers.
